Aging Skin Symptoms During their
late 40s, 60% of all women experience changes in their skin. Reduction in estrogen
and other hormonal fluctuations reduce the production of collagen. Skin begins
to thin, making it vulnerable to lines, wrinkles, bruising and sensitivity.
Some women experience increased oil production and acne,
similar to that of their teenage years. Others find themselves with very dry and
itchy skin. Some have trouble achieving balance between the two. Loss of supporting
tissues leads to dilated blood vessels and brown spots, and unregulated heat production
leaves pores open and vulnerable. The needs
of aging skin are complex, and each need must be addressed individually and specifically.
Sallowness is relieved by gentle exfoliants to slough off dead cells. Dryness
relates to less stimulation of the sebaceous glands. Water is wonderful for the
skin, but cannot alone overcome dry skin. Professional products and home
care routines can lessen or alleviate enlarged pores, wrinkles, liver spots, rough

is at your fingertips If you have recently gone through changes
and challenges (and who among us hasnt), you may find yourself experiencing
increased oil production. Where does all that oil settle? In your pores,
of course, leading to clogging with dead skin cells and bacteria. Consistency
in skin therapy is a requirement for anti-aging beauty. But, are you adding to
your skin problems inadvertently? Remember when your mother told you to keep your
hands away from your face? Well, she was right, and you need to be consistent
in that too. Bacteria on our hands can make even minor skin-problems much worse. Stress
is an acne activator, and with stress, some people suffer from a condition called
stress trauma or excoriation. This disorder is characterized by excessive picking,
scratching or squeezing of normal skin or skin with surface irregularities. Some
are convinced that trying to remove the bacteria in a blemish speeds up healing;
however, the reality is that it not only slows healing down, but can add to permanent
scars as well. Put your best... effort... forward,
